Step 4: Configure Dedupe. AlertMux collapses duplicate pages before they hit the on-call rotation at Vexhall Systems. Deploy the worker, confirm it registers with the Pagegate broker, then edit /etc/alertmux/prod.env. Do not copy values from staging; they differ. The broker rejects unauthenticated workers silently, so this must be correct. Add the following line to the env file now.

secret setting of yagef-baweg: RELAY_SECRET29=cb53deb59a49ed54d9f43599b54ca

Following the annual count at the Fennmoor warehouse, Ravelin Components will record a write-down on obsolete stock of the Axion 200 controller line. The root cause is the faster-than-expected transition of customers to the Axion 300, combined with an overbuy authorized in the prior fiscal year. Controls have been revised: procurement now requires demand-planning sign-off above threshold quantities. Auditors at Thackeray & Lowe have reviewed the methodology. The confidential remediation and disposal plan follows below.

board note of kageg-bahof: The renewal with Holwynax Holdings closes at $2 million a year, 5 percent below the last contract. Project Ulaath slips by two quarters because of the supplier delay.

# Break-Glass Access: Datelocale Service

New to Quennel? Read this first. The Datelocale service formats dates per region for the Varnholt suite. If localization breaks in production and the on-call owner is unreachable, break-glass applies. Use it only when all regional formatters are down. Access grants 30 minutes of write scope to the locale tables. Every use is logged and reviewed next morning. To unlock the break-glass console, enter the recovery passphrase below.

recovery phrase for fajep-yaweg: gilath-sorox-wenius-rusdor-keliel-zorius